For Emerald Paisley Marina Burrow and Josiah Patrick Newton, football has always been more than just a sport-it's been their refuge. As players for the Missouri State Bears, they are part of a historic transformation, helping the program make the leap from FCS to FBS competition. But behind the cheers and championship aspirations, they carry secrets no teammate can know.

Both Emerald and Josiah are transgender, out and proud online but forced to navigate the hyper-masculine world of college football in silence. Yet, no secret is as dangerous as the one Emerald keeps buried-the horrific sexual crimes committed against her within the very program he represents. The scars remain long after the final whistle, but when no justice comes, he and Emerald are forced to leave it all behind.

Two and a half years later, they return.

The Bears are on the cusp of history, playing for a conference championship and a shocking berth in the 14-team College Football Playoff. But with their comeback comes the ghosts of the past-whispers in the locker room, threats from the shadows, and a conspiracy that runs deeper than they ever imagined.

As the championship game approaches, Josiah receives an anonymous message:

"You should have stayed gone. Play this game, and you'll never leave the field alive."
